Product details
Overview
MAXREFDES112A# from Maxim Integrated is an isolated 24V-to-12V, 10W flyback power supply reference design built around the MAX17596 peak-current-mode controller. It delivers 12V at up to 800mA (±5% output accuracy), achieves 88% peak efficiency at 24V input, and features functional insulation with through-hole mounting for rapid prototyping in industrial control systems.

Technical Context
The MAXREFDES112A# implements a wide-input (17–36V) isolated flyback topology using the MAX17596 controller, which integrates a 1% accurate internal voltage reference and programmable switching frequency (100kHz–1MHz; set to 500kHz here). It employs optocoupler-based feedback with TL431 for precise 12V output regulation under varying load conditions.
Protection features include EN/UVLO (17V startup), OVI (36V shutdown), soft-start via SS pin capacitor, hiccup-mode overcurrent protection, and thermal shutdown. Transformer selection is simplified by pre-qualification of four global vendors' parts-including Wurth 750315882 for this variant-ensuring reliable isolation and manufacturability.
Key Specifications
| Parameter | Value and Actual Design Meaning |
|---|---|
| Input Voltage Range | 17V to 36V DC - supports industrial 24V nominal rails with brownout and overvoltage tolerance. |
| Output Voltage | 12V ±5% - regulated via optocoupler + TL431 feedback loop; stable across 0–800mA load. |
| Output Power | 10W maximum - delivered as 12V @ 800mA, with 20% current headroom (960mA peak). |
| Peak Efficiency | 88% at 24V input - measured with supplied components; enables compact thermal design. |
| Switching Frequency | 500kHz - fixed setting for optimized magnetic size, EMI performance, and transient response. |
| Isolation Rating | Functional insulation - meets basic isolation requirements for industrial I/O and PLC interfaces. |
| Output Ripple | 110mVP-P at full load - measured at 24V input, 800mA output; includes switching spike. |

FAQ
What is the input voltage range supported by the MAXREFDES112A#?
The MAXREFDES112A# operates over a 17V to 36V DC input range. This accommodates standard 24V industrial supplies while providing robust undervoltage lockout (17V startup) and overvoltage protection (36V shutdown), ensuring reliable operation during line fluctuations and brownout events. The MAXREFDES112A# maintains regulation throughout this range.
What transformer is used on the MAXREFDES112A# board?
The MAXREFDES112A# uses the Wurth Electronics transformer part number 750315882. This part is pre-qualified for the design and provides the required turns ratio, isolation rating, and leakage inductance to meet efficiency, regulation, and safety targets. Other variants (e.g., MAXREFDES112B#) use different transformers, but the MAXREFDES112A# specifically integrates the Wurth 750315882.
Does the MAXREFDES112A# provide galvanic isolation between input and output?
Yes, the MAXREFDES112A# provides functional galvanic isolation via its flyback transformer and optocoupler-based feedback circuit. It achieves reinforced insulation capability suitable for industrial I/O and PLC auxiliary power applications where ground separation and noise immunity are critical. The MAXREFDES112A# does not claim safety-rated (e.g., UL/IEC 60950-1) isolation without additional certification testing.
What is the output current capability and accuracy of the MAXREFDES112A#?
The MAXREFDES112A# delivers up to 800mA continuously at 12V with ±5% output voltage accuracy across line, load, and temperature. It supports up to 960mA (20% overrange) in short-duration hiccup-limited conditions. Output accuracy is maintained by the MAX17596's 1% internal reference and precision TL431/optocoupler feedback network in the MAXREFDES112A# implementation.
Can the MAXREFDES112A# be used directly in a production system?
The MAXREFDES112A# is a fully assembled, tested reference design intended for evaluation and rapid prototyping. While it meets functional performance targets-including 88% peak efficiency and low output ripple-it requires system-level validation for EMI compliance, thermal management, and long-term reliability before production deployment. The MAXREFDES112A# provides all design files (Gerber, BOM, schematics) to support derivative production designs.
